Your First Visit
Your first visit to True Life Chiropractic typically includes:
1. Consultation
We will discuss your health history, current symptoms, injuries, lifestyle, and health goals.
2. Examination
A chiropractic examination may include posture evaluation, range of motion testing, orthopedic testing, neurological testing, and movement assessments.
3. X-Rays (If Needed)
If necessary, we may refer you to a local imaging center for X-rays to better evaluate your spine and condition.
4. Report of Findings
After reviewing your exam and any imaging, the doctor will explain:
- What is causing your problem
- How we can help
- Recommended treatment plan
- How often you should come in
- Estimated length of care
- Costs and payment options
5. Treatment
Most patients can receive their first treatment the same day. Treatment may include chiropractic adjustments, therapy, or soft tissue work depending on your condition.
The Three Phases of Chiropractic Care
Most chiropractic treatment plans follow three phases of care that support recovery and long-term health.
Phase 1: Relief Care
If you are experiencing pain when you visit our Anchorage chiropractic clinic, the first goal is to reduce pain and begin the healing process.
During the relief phase, chiropractic care focuses on reducing inflammation, relieving pressure on nerves, improving spinal movement, and decreasing muscle tension.
Depending on the severity of the condition, patients may initially require visits two to three times per week for several weeks to help stabilize the affected area.
Phase 2: Corrective or Restorative Care
Once the initial pain improves, the next stage focuses on restoring proper function to the spine and supporting tissues.
During corrective chiropractic care, muscles, ligaments, and joints continue to heal while spinal alignment and movement are gradually improved. This stage helps reduce the risk of recurring injuries and supports long-term recovery.
Treatment frequency during this phase usually decreases as the body regains strength and stability.
Phase 3: Wellness Care
After the body has recovered and symptoms have improved, many patients choose to continue chiropractic care as part of a long-term wellness routine.
Wellness chiropractic care focuses on maintaining spinal health, improving mobility, and helping prevent future problems. Periodic chiropractic visits may help support posture, flexibility, and overall physical function.
Many patients visit once or twice per month during this phase to maintain optimal spinal health.
